Key Elements of Earthquake-Safe Decking
Robust Footings
The foundation of your deck is critical for stability. Use deep, concrete footings that are set below the frost line to provide a solid anchor, preventing upheaval during seismic activity.
Features
- Concrete with rebar reinforcement
- Depth beyond the frost line for added stability
- Wider base for better load distribution
Shear Walls and Bracing
Incorporate shear walls and diagonal bracing in your deck’s design to enhance lateral strength. These components are crucial for absorbing and distributing seismic forces, reducing the risk of collapse.
Features
- Plywood sheathing attached to deck framing
- Diagonal metal braces connecting deck joists to footings
- Steel connectors reinforcing joints
Quality Fasteners and Connectors
Use high-quality, corrosion-resistant fasteners and connectors to ensure all parts of your deck stay firmly joined together. This helps to maintain the integrity of the structure during an earthquake.
Features
- Galvanized or stainless steel screws and bolts
- Heavy-duty metal brackets and ties
- Reinforced joist hangers
Flexible Decking Materials
Opt for materials that offer both durability and flexibility. Composites and treated wood can withstand seismic forces better than some rigid materials, reducing the risk of cracking and breakage.
Features
- Composite materials with flexibility and resilience
- Pressure-treated wood for enhanced durability
- UV and moisture-resistant options
Best Practices for Earthquake-Safe Deck Construction
Comprehensive Site Assessment
Before construction begins, assess your site thoroughly. Understanding soil conditions and potential seismic impacts is crucial for designing a sturdy foundation.
Professional Design and Engineering
Work with experienced professionals like Pacific Peak Decks who understand the nuances of earthquake-safe construction. Customized design and engineering ensure that your deck meets all local and structural requirements.
Regular Maintenance and Inspections
Regular maintenance and inspections are vital for keeping your deck in top condition. Check for signs of wear, rust, or structural weakness, and address them promptly to maintain earthquake resistance.
Permit and Code Compliance
Ensure all construction complies with local building codes and permits. Staying up-to-date with regulations helps to keep your deck legally compliant and structurally sound.

FAQs
Do I need a special permit to build an earthquake-safe deck?
Yes, building a deck in San Bernardino requires permits to ensure compliance with local building codes designed for earthquake safety.
How often should my deck be inspected for earthquake safety?
Regular inspections are recommended at least once a year and after any significant seismic activity.
What materials are best for earthquake-resistant decks?
Composite materials, pressure-treated wood, and high-quality metal fasteners and connectors are ideal.
Can I retrofit my existing deck for better earthquake resistance?
Yes, many existing decks can be retrofitted with additional bracing, fastening, and foundation reinforcement to enhance earthquake safety.
